Summer Salad: Peach and Beef Bacon Bliss
- Uniquely combines juicy peaches with crispy beef bacon.
- Quick and ideal for a nutritious meal on hot summer days.
- Colorful and visually appealing, pleasing to both eyes and taste buds.
Ingredients
- 2 ripe peaches, sliced
- 6 slices of beef bacon, cooked and crumbled
- 4 cups of mixed greens (arugula, spinach, and kale)
- 1/2 cup of crumbled feta cheese
- 1/3 cup of walnuts, toasted
- 2 tablespoons of balsamic glaze
- Salt and pepper, to taste
How to Make
To make this Summer Salad, start by cooking the beef bacon until crispy. Allow it to cool before crumbling it into bite-sized pieces. In a large bowl, toss together the mixed greens, sliced peaches, and crumbled feta cheese. Next, sprinkle the toasted walnuts for an added crunch. Drizzle the salad with balsamic glaze and season with salt and pepper to your liking. Gently mix all the ingredients, ensuring the flavors blend beautifully, then serve immediately for a crisp, refreshing dish.
Tips
- Choose ripe peaches for the sweetest flavor and juiciness.
- Experiment with different nuts, like pecans or almonds, for variation.
Make-Ahead
You can prepare the individual components ahead of time. Keep the greens and fruits separate until you’re ready to serve for maximum freshness.
Storing
Store leftover salad ingredients separately in airtight containers in the fridge. Keep the dressing on the side to prevent the greens from wilting.
Freezing
Freezing is not recommended for this salad due to the texture changes in fresh fruits once thawed.
Reheating
Since this is a salad, simply enjoy it cold. If you have leftover bacon, warm it separately in a skillet before adding it back to the salad.
Serving Suggestions
This salad pairs beautifully with grilled chicken or fish for a complete meal. Add a slice of crusty bread for a fulfilling lunch or serve it as a light dinner along with a glass of chilled white wine.
